Sense Bytes

- When enabled to do so (the IRS bit of the Flags-1 field of the

Pass-through command is not set), the RF3880 adapter automatically responds
to Check Condition status from a device, with a Request Sense command.

The device answers the Request Sense command by returning information
about its condition. This information is called Sense Bytes. Depending on the
peripheral, up to 256 Sense Bytes can be returned in response to the Request
Sense command.

There are three ways that Sense Bytes can be reported to you by the RF3880
via the Sense Bytes fields of the Status Block:

The first eight bytes of Sense data returned (this is the default).

Up to 32 of the first sequential Sense Bytes.

Up to 16 of any of the 256 possible Sense Bytes returned.

You can specify one of these methods, for Sense Bytes to be reported in the
Status Block of Initiator Pass-through commands, by using the Unit Options
or Extended Unit Options Board-control command (See Chapter 7).

If no Check Condition status occurred, or the automatic Request Sense
capability of the adapter is not enabled, the Sense Bytes fields will all be zero.
See page 5 - 4 for more information about how to inhibit the automatic Request
Sense command (using the IRS bit).
